> 4-byte alignment binaries should have ELFOSABI_SYSV (0) (since that ABI 
> spec is where the 4 byte alignment comes from).  If Linux/m68k is 
> already using that, then those binaries are broken by definition.
> 
> Let’s hope existing Linux/m68k binaries are using ELFOSABI_LINUX / 
> ELFOSABI_GNU (3) (sorry, I don’t have any handy to check).
> 
> If the existing binaries correctly label themselves has having the 
> Linux-specific ABI, then this is trivial and there’s no reason to use a 
> note to differentiate them.
